Problems solved by technology

[0006] However, in the process of realizing the present invention, the inventor found that the defect of the prior art is: in actual network operation, the IP address conflict may only be temporary, but due to the conflicting IP address is marked as unallocated and placed into IP address conflict queue, even after the IP address conflict disappears, the DHCP server still cannot allocate the previously conflicted IP address in time

Embodiment 1

[0024] Embodiments of the present invention provide a method for recovering an IP address, such as figure 1 As shown, the method includes:

[0025] Step 101, the Dynamic Host Configuration Protocol DHCP server detects whether there is a conflict in the IP address in the IP address conflict queue;

[0026] Step 102, clear the IP address without conflict from the IP address conflict queue, and add the IP address into the address pool, so as to realize address recycling.

[0027] In this embodiment, when the DHCP server assigns an IP address to the client according to the request of the client, the DHCP server can obtain an assignable IP address from the DHCP address pool, and then the DHCP server detects the IP address through the ICMP message After the conflict, or after the DHCP server receives the DHCP reject message sent by the DHCP client, it puts the IP address into the IP address conflict queue. Embodiment 2

[0031] An embodiment of the present invention provides a method for reclaiming an IP address.

[0032] In this embodiment, when the initial time t=0, after the DHCP server puts the conflicting IP address into the IP address conflicting queue, it can be counted by a set timer, and when the time counted by the timer reaches the first preset time, Start to detect the IP addresses in the IP address conflict queue, and reclaim the IP addresses according to the detection results. Wherein, if a conflicting IP address is detected again within the first preset time, the timer may no longer be set.

[0033] For example, when the initial moment t=0, the DHCP server detects that the IP address P1 conflicts, and P1 is put into the IP address conflict queue. Abstract

The embodiment of the invention provides a recovering method of an IP address and a DHCP server. The recovering method of the IP address comprises the following steps: a dynamic host configuration protocol (DHCP) server detects whether conflict exists in the IP address in an IP address conflict queue; the IP address with no conflict is eliminated from the IP address conflict queue; and the IP address is added to an address pool. By the embodiment of the invention, the conflict IP address can be recovered timely, thus ensuring that enough allocable IP addresses exist in the DHCP address pool and improving the availability of the DHCP service.

Description

technical field [0001] The invention relates to a dynamic host configuration protocol (DHCP) technology, in particular to an IP address recovery method and a DHCP server. Background technique [0002] Dynamic Host Configure Protocol (DHCP, Dynamic Host Configure Protocol) is based on the client / server working mode, and the DHCP server assigns IP addresses and other parameters to the DHCP clients that need dynamic configuration. [0003] In the IP address allocation process, in order to prevent the newly allocated IP address from conflicting with the existing IP address in the current network, it can be detected from the server side and the client side. [0004] When the IP address conflict is detected from the server side, before the DHCP server allocates the IP address to the DHCP client, the conflict detection can be completed by using an Internet Information Control Protocol (ICMP, Internet Control Message Protocol) message.
